The Volkswagen Transporter, often referred to simply as the VW Transporter, is a versatile and enduring commercial vehicle renowned for its reliability and practicality. Manufactured by Volkswagen Commercial Vehicles, a division of the German automaker Volkswagen AG, it has a rich history dating back to its initial release in the mid-20th century. Introduced in 1950, the Transporter has evolved through multiple generations, each enhancing its performance, comfort, and efficiency. Known for its distinctive boxy design and robust build, the model is popular among businesses and individuals alike. Core features typically include flexible cargo space, efficient engines, and advanced safety options, making it a standout choice in the van segment. Its reputation for durability and adaptability continues to make the Volkswagen Transporter a preferred vehicle for various commercial and leisure applications.
